The water-test method: why and how it works
A practical, low-risk test for uncertain plates is the water test. By heating a cup of water beside the plate, you can observe how the dish behaves under microwave conditions without exposing food to potential contaminants. If the plate remains cool and the water heats normally, the plate is likely safe for typical use. If the plate becomes very hot, warps, or emits an unusual odor, it’s a sign to stop using it in the microwave. Water-test protocol you can follow at home
Prepare a shallow test: place the plate in the microwave with a cup of water adjacent to it (not on top of the plate). Run the microwave on medium power for one minute. After the cycle, carefully touch the plate edge and center (using caution). If the plate is cool to the touch and the water is hot, you have reasonable assurance of safety for typical reheating tasks. If the plate feels warm or hot, or if there are visible cracks, discard it for microwave use. Always start with a clean plate and avoid any plate with metal accents. This protocol minimizes risk while giving clear, observable results.
What to avoid: metals, paints with metal, and decorative glazes
Never microwave plates with metallic rims, gilded accents, or metal-based paints. These features can arc, spark, or heat unevenly, posing a fire risk and potentially damaging your microwave. Glazes that include metal particles or metallic decoration should be treated as unsafe for microwave use, even if the plate bears a generic “microwave safe” tag elsewhere. When in doubt, select plates without metal in the glaze and with simple, unmetallic finishes. Material-specific guidance: ceramic, porcelain, glass, and stoneware
Different materials react differently under microwave heating. Ceramic and porcelain plates with proper, lead-free glazes and no metal trim are generally safe. Glass plates without metal patterns are typically safe too, but tempered or decorative glass can crack under rapid heating. Stoneware often tolerates microwaves if it lacks metallic glaze and is labeled as microwave safe. If you rely on tests, ensure you do not overheat glaze or cause bubbling; the goal is to verify safe behavior under normal use rather than to prove maximum heat resistance.
Visual cues that signal unsafe plates
Inspect for visible cracks, deep crazing, or glaze that shows signs of separation. These visual cues may indicate structural weakness that worsens with heat, potentially releasing materials into food or causing plate failure. Uneven texture, a rough edge, or chipping can also point to unsafe performance. If you notice any of these signs, do not microwave the plate and replace it with a known microwave-safe option. Microwaved plates should have smooth surfaces and no visible damage.
Cleaning and maintenance for safe utensils
Regular cleaning prevents residue buildup that can affect heating patterns. Use mild dish soap and a soft sponge, avoiding abrasive pads that could scratch glaze or crack patterns. After microwaving, inspect for any new cracks or glaze flaking. Proper storage—avoiding stacked piles that press into surfaces—helps preserve markings and reduces the chance of hidden damage. Keeping a dedicated set of microwave-safe dishes improves reliability and reduces confusion in busy kitchens.
